Siemens 3VA1225-6GF42-0HH0 — 250 A SENTRON MCCB, 4-Pole, Line Protection
The Siemens 3VA1225-6GF42-0HH0 is a SENTRON molded case circuit breaker (MCCB) rated at 250 A continuous, four-pole construction, designed for line protection in distribution and industrial power panels. Breaking capacity hits 220 kA at 240 V, 154 kA at 415 V, 75.6 kA at 440 V, 30 kA at 500 V, and 17 kA at 690 V — that covers fault-current duty from low-voltage service entrances up to 690 V motor control centers without cascading upstream.
Thermal Derating and Power Loss
Rated 250 A from 40 °C through 50 °C ambient; above that it derates in 5 °C steps: 243 A at 55 °C, 237 A at 60 °C, 230 A at 65 °C, and 223 A at 70 °C. Maximum power loss is 57 W — that matters for enclosure heat rise calculations when the panel is fully populated.
Auxiliary and Release Configuration
Shipped with a shunt trip (STL) release and two auxiliary switches plus one trip alarm switch (HQ). No undervoltage release fitted from the factory. No ground-fault monitoring version. The auxiliary switch design is 2 auxiliary switches + 1 trip alarm switch HQ.
Dimensions and Mounting
Footprint: 140 mm wide × 158 mm high × 70 mm deep. That 70 mm depth is the body-only — verify clearance for the shunt trip and auxiliary wiring when laying out the DIN-rail or backplate. Four-pole width at 140 mm is standard for this frame size; check adjacent device spacing for heat dissipation.
